Course contents :  
The BAP1 course is designed to serve as introduction to earth sciences ; it is split in 2 main parts:
1) geology : a. formation & composition of the earth b. isostasy & continental drift c. erosion & sedimentation d. diagenesis & metamorphism e. tectonic & volcanology
2) dynamic geomorphology : a. river erosion & aggradation b. pediments, inselbergs & peneplanation c. slope erosion d. glacial erosion, inlandsis, mountain models e. eolian erosion f. cycles of erosion
Learning outcomes of the course :  
1) acquisition of basis knowledge about the earth crust & its evolution
2) comprehension of phenomena leading to the formation & the evolution of natural landscapes
